高岭石无定形化的动力学研究

摘    要:Amorphous kaolinite derivatives were prepared through mixing kaolinite with HCOOK and KOH solution. Ki-netics of kaolinite being turned into amorphous derivatvies was investigated by XRD. It showed that the transfor-mation included dynamic and diffuse controlling stages. And the active energy E1=26.8kJ·mol-1; E2=12.2 kJ·mol-1. TEM and SEM images showed that particle size of the amorphous derivatives was about 50nm. And the amorphous derivatives seemed like alumnsilicate gel, accompanied by some aggregates.
